Lt304888.ru

Туристические услуги

PXE

05-07-2023

PXE (англ. Preboot eXecution Environment, произносится пикси) — среда для загрузки компьютеров с помощью сетевой карты без использования жёстких дисков, компакт-дисков и других устройств, применяемых при загрузке операционной системы. Для организации загрузки системы в PXE используются протоколы IP, UDP, BOOTP и TFTP.

PXE-код, обычно находящийся в ПЗУ сетевой карты, получает из сети по протоколу TFTP (получив адрес TFTP-сервера по BOOTP) исполняемый файл, после чего передаёт ему управление.

Спецификация PXE ограничивает размер загрузчика 32 килобайтами, поэтому иногда используется двухстадийная загрузка, когда первый загрузчик получает и запускает вторичный, который уже получает и запускает образ операционной системы.

Одна из реализаций загружаемого по PXE файла — pxelinux из комплекта программ syslinux. pxelinux умеет показывать пользователю меню, похожее на меню syslinux и загружать по сети и передавать управление ядру Linux и программам, имеющим идентичный формат загрузки (например, Memtest86).

Для Windows систем существует специально разработанная сборка, демонстрирующая возможности загрузки и передачи управления не только Linux-ядру, но и образам ISO-дисков BartPE, которые являются прототипами ядра Windows: Tauru$ PXE Environment v1.0

См. также

Ссылки

  • PXE спецификация (англ.)
  • PXE — подготовка Linux-системы в качестве сервера для загрузки по PXE
  • QNX4PXEBooting — Загрузка QNX4 с помощью PXE
  • How to create Network Bootable Images under Windows (англ.)


PXE.

© 2020–2023 lt304888.ru, Россия, Волжский, ул. Больничная 49, +7 (8443) 85-29-01